Why You Shouldn't Ignore That Drip
A slow plumbing leak can go unnoticed for weeks or even months. The longer it persists, the more potential damage it can cause. Here are some dangers associated with slow leaks:
- Mold Growth: Moist environments are perfect breeding grounds for mold, which can lead to health issues and costly remediation.
- Structural Damage: Water can weaken the integrity of your walls and floors, leading to expensive repairs.
- Increased Water Bills: You may notice a spike in your water bill without realizing it’s due to that tiny leak.

Recognizing Signs of a Slow Plumbing Leak
So how do you know if you have a slow leak? Keep an eye out for:
- Water Stains: Dark spots on ceilings or walls can indicate ongoing moisture issues.
- Peeling Paint or Wallpaper: This can be a sign of water accumulation behind surfaces.
- Musty Odors: A persistent damp smell often signals hidden leaks.
- Warped Flooring: If your floors start to buckle or warp, moisture could be the culprit.

How to Prevent Slow Plumbing Leaks in Santa Ana Homes
Preventing leaks before they start is crucial. Here are some proactive steps for Santa Ana homeowners:
- Regular Inspections: Periodically check pipes and connections for corrosion or wear.
- Maintain Your Appliances: Ensure your washing machine, dishwasher, and water heater are in good condition.
- Monitor Your Water Bill: Keep an eye on your usage; a sudden increase can signal a leak.
- Insulate Pipes: This helps prevent freezing and bursting during colder months.
